Lady Scots Closing In On 10-4A Title

The Highland Park volleyball team has completely dominated its District 10-4A opponents so far this season.

With five matches remaining in the regular season, including tonight’s 6:30 contest at Terrell, the Lady Scots have yet to lose a single game in district play. Nine matches, nine sweeps.

Ranked No. 3 in the Texas Girls Coaches Association’s Class 4A state poll, Highland Park (31-6) is shooting for its second consecutive perfect run through district play. The Lady Scots have won 26 straight district matches.

Highland Park has a two-match lead on Carrollton Creekview (20-16, 8-2) in the 10-4A standings. Following tonight’s match, Highland Park will play at West Mesquite (Friday), at home against Forney (Oct. 22) and Creekview (Oct. 25), and at North Forney (Oct. 29) to close the regular season.
